Dimitri G. Karcazes, principal in the firm's Bankruptcy & Creditors' Right Group, will present on a panel at the Turnaround Management Association's Chicago/Midwest Chapter's Double Header Event on May 11, 2010, in Chicago.

Mr. Karcazes will speak on a panel during the morning session entitled, "13-Week Cash Flow," which will focus on the theoretical elements and practical applications of cash budgets for companies in financial distress. It will include a comprehensive study of the principles of cash budgeting with a particular emphasis on working capital management, key model assumptions and drivers, and the contexts and applications of cash flow models relative to the priorities of various parties-in-interest of complex capital structures. It will also include the analysis and performance of borrowing base calculations and a liquidation analysis.

The afternoon session entitled, "Strategic Alternatives for Distressed Businesses," will focus on the options available to CEOs and their advisors when the cash—and patience—run out. Participants will learn from an interactive panel discussion on the alternative processes and tools most effectively and commonly used by businesses and their lenders in distressed circumstances.
